Output 74363fca5023854f24e06a6819ede262433598c127952eb645f9552f7b249b84:0

value
3310697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07b16993624609a2ac536a29ba689059011a3bb8 OP_EQUAL
address
32PhBiWq69c6KSgebfxrxmKQLz6Pq3vhfP
transaction
74363fca5023854f24e06a6819ede262433598c127952eb645f9552f7b249b84
spent
true